Filing 5 MEMORANDUM DECISION AND ORDER. The plaintiff's complaint is dismissed for failure to state a claim. See 28 U.S.C. 1915(e)(2)(B)(ii). The Court grants the plaintiff leave to file an amended complaint within 30 days. Any new complaint must be captioned Amended Complaint and bear the same docket number as this order. If plaintiff chooses to file an amended complaint, he should clarify the circumstances under which his car was impounded, and also submit supporting materials. All further proceedings are stayed for 30 days. If the plaintiff does not file an amended complaint within 30 days, judgment must be entered. The Court certifies p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 1915(a)(3) that any appeal from this order would not be taken in good faith and therefore in forma pauperis status is denied for the purpose of any appeal. Ordered by Judge Ann M. Donnelly on 5/25/2022. (Greene, Donna) |
